Sheryl-Underwood
Sheryl Underwood, an American comedian and television host most well-known as host for The Talk, a popular talk show broadcast on daytime television. Sheryl was lived in Little Rock. Sheryl was raised in an extremely difficult household. She was a child who spent a lot of time caring for her younger sibling Frankie. Frankie was a victim of polio. As she grew older it was not easy to get along with her mum. Sheryl says that at one instance her mother stabbed her father because he was becoming too close to her. Sheryl was a college graduate when she and joining the army, was an active participant in. But her passion was comedy. She was selected as the first female winner of the Miller Lite Comedy Search, held in 1989. In 1992, she made her TV debut with regular appearances on the HBO show Def Comedy Jam. She hosted a show on television at the time of her debut on Oh Drama! The present guest co-host for the Talk talk show since 2011. Additionally, she's appeared in a variety of fictional characters on series such as Bulworth Nikki as well as Beauty Shop.
